Subject: DR drill — Hoistline simulator

Maintainers: quarterly drill complete. Hoistline elevator-dispatch simulator restored from cold backup in 41 minutes. Dispatch replay diverged on floor-queue ties; fix tracked separately. Restore script now requires the sealed recovery credential at step 4. For audit continuity, the current recovery passphrase is recorded immediately below this message.

unlock words, fafop-hawep: briwyn-oliix-sorox

## Build Provenance — Contrast Audit Tooling

The Glimmerpane contrast audit now runs as a reproducible pipeline step. Each report records the exact ruleset version, the palette snapshot, and the renderer used, so audit results from different weeks are comparable. Failures block merge only on AA-level violations. For the weekly sync, the audit run discussed here corresponds to the token below.

pipeline stamp: htk31_f769b577b3028a4e9958e5bb8d1259a

### Date localization quick fix

Hey, welcome aboard! When Fennwick Scheduler shows dates wrong for the Veldoria region, it usually means the locale service token expired. The formatter calls out to our Tidemark locale API on startup, so it needs auth to fetch format packs. Open the .env in the app root and drop the token line in right here:

sealed setting: ARCHIVE_KEY3=bbe